Held from 6–8 March 2026 in Lakeland, Florida (USA), the competition was organized by the Society of Automotive Engineers (SAE) with support from leading aerospace companies, including Lockheed Martin, manufacturer of the F-16 and F-35 aircraft. The event brought together university teams from around the world to compete in the design, construction, and flight performance of unmanned aircraft.
Competing in the highly competitive Regular Class, the Poznan University of Technology team outperformed 35 international teams to secure first place overall as well as first place in the Flight category. This achievement matches the University's previous best result, achieved in California in 2018. Unlike in 2018, however, the 2026 aircraft was piloted by a student from the University's own Academic Aviation Club (AKL).
The winning team consisted of Agata Chojnacka, Antoni Dąbkiewicz, Kajetan Michalak, Marcel Kraśniewski, Mikołaj Lewandowski (pilot), Antoni Paprocki, Aleksandra Paśko, and Kacper Zabojski (team captain). The academic supervisor of the PUT Aero Design team was Dr Radosław Górzeński.
The team presented an unmanned aircraft featuring:
- a 304 cm wingspan,
- an empty weight of 6.5 kg,
- a payload capacity of approximately 15 kg,
- a lightweight truss-frame plywood structure covered with film,
- aluminium wing spars,
- a Selig airfoil with winglets,
- two TMotor electric motors powered by a LiPo 4S 2000 mAh battery,
- and a cruising speed of approximately 12 m/s.

The competition attracted teams from India, Mexico, Brazil, Poland, Puerto Rico, Canada, the United States, and Slovenia.
For more than 40 years, SAE Aero Design has been one of the world's leading academic aerospace engineering competitions. Student teams are challenged to design, build, document, present, and successfully fly an aircraft capable of carrying the greatest possible payload while meeting strict competition requirements. Beyond technical excellence, the competition develops participants' project management, teamwork, problem-solving, communication, and engineering design skills.
Prof. Jerzy Nawrocki of Poznan University of Technology summarized the educational value of the competition:
"Competitions such as SAE Aero Design transform engineering education from 'learning by reading' into 'learning by doing'."
The Poznan University of Technology team has participated in SAE Aero Design since 2008, continuing a strong tradition of Polish success in the competition.
The team's participation forms part of the project "Design and Construction of Unmanned Aircraft for International Academic Competitions (2025–2026)", funded by the Polish Ministry of Science and Higher Education under the programme "Support for Students in Enhancing Their Competencies and Skills." Additional financial and organizational support has been provided by Poznan University of Technology, its Faculties of Environmental and Energy Engineering and Civil and Transport Engineering, the Poznań Aero Club, the City of Poznań, and numerous industry partners.
Following their victory in Florida, the team will continue competing internationally throughout 2026 at:
- Aero Design Mexico (Querétaro, Mexico),
- SAE Aero Design West (Fort Worth, Texas, USA),
- AUVSI SUAS (Tulsa, Oklahoma, USA),
- and TeknoFest (Şanlıurfa, Türkiye).
